Building a Resilient Agile Release Train in 7 Steps

Building a Resilient Agile Release Train in 7 Steps

Building a resilient Agile Release Train in 7 steps is a crucial process for any organisation looking to achieve success in todays fast-paced and ever-changing business environment. Essential Tools for Streamlining Your Agile Release Train . An Agile Release Train (ART) is a team of Agile teams that work together to deliver value to the customer in a consistent and timely manner. The ART is the backbone of an organisations Agile transformation, and building a resilient ART is essential for ensuring that the organisation can respond quickly and effectively to changes in the market.


The first step in building a resilient ART is to establish a clear vision and goals for the train. This involves defining the purpose of the train, the desired outcomes, and the key performance indicators that will be used to measure success. By having a clear vision and goals, the team can stay focused and aligned on what they are trying to achieve, which is essential for building resilience.


The second step is to assemble a cross-functional team of experts who will be responsible for driving the ART forward. This team should include representatives from all areas of the organisation, including product management, development, testing, and operations. By having a diverse team with a range of skills and perspectives, the ART can benefit from a variety of insights and ideas, which will help to build resilience.


The third step is to establish a cadence for the train, including regular planning, review, and retrospective sessions. By having a predictable cadence, the team can ensure that they are consistently delivering value to the customer and can quickly identify and address any issues that arise. This regular rhythm also helps to build trust and collaboration within the team, which is essential for resilience.


The fourth step is to define and prioritise the trains backlog of work. This involves breaking down the work into smaller, manageable pieces and prioritising them based on value and risk. By having a well-defined backlog, the team can quickly adapt to changing priorities and ensure that they are always working on the most important items.


The fifth step is to establish a continuous integration and deployment pipeline. This involves automating the build, test, and deployment processes so that the team can quickly and reliably deliver value to the customer. By having a robust pipeline in place, the team can respond quickly to changes in the market and ensure that they are always delivering high-quality products.


The sixth step is to foster a culture of continuous improvement within the team. This involves encouraging team members to experiment, learn from their mistakes, and constantly seek out ways to improve their processes and practices. By fostering a culture of continuous improvement, the team can quickly adapt to changes in the market and build resilience.


The final step is to monitor and measure the trains performance on an ongoing basis. This involves tracking key performance indicators, such as lead time, cycle time, and defect rate, and using this data to identify areas for improvement. By monitoring and measuring performance, the team can quickly identify and address any issues that arise, ensuring that the train remains resilient and effective.


In conclusion, building a resilient Agile Release Train in 7 steps is a complex process that requires careful planning, collaboration, and continuous improvement. By following these steps, organisations can ensure that their ART is able to respond quickly and effectively to changes in the market, delivering value to the customer in a consistent and timely manner.